    How to choose the number of ports on a cable management rack

    To figure out the number of ports, you need to: For example, count your current devices (computers, cameras, printers), add 20% to 30% depending on your environment, to account for future expansion, and then select the nearest standard patch panel size, rounding up as needed. Patch panel port density indicates the number of ports available within a particular amount of rack space. Rack height is measured in rack units (U). 75.     How many cable management racks should be installed in one server rack

    Vertical cable managers, typically 22RU or 44RU, mount on the sides of your rack and provide channels for cables running the full height of the rack. It ensures that different connections between servers, networking equipment, and power sources remain orderly and accessible. A typical rack environment. Take note of your servers, switches, and other devices, power distribution units (PDUs) locations, and available rack space to plan clean cable paths that avoid clutter, maintain airflow, and simplify maintenance.
